問題タブ [visual-studio-extensions]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
5300 参照

visual-studio-2010 - クラスとメソッドのレポート

クラスとメソッドに関するデータを含むレポートを生成するためのツールまたは拡張機能はありますか?たとえば、すべてのクラスと各クラスに含まれるメソッドの概要を、両方の数とともに表示します。

0 投票する
2 に答える
15911 参照

c# - Visual Studio テキスト エディター拡張機能

Visual Studio (2010) 拡張機能の使用を開始しようとしていますが、適切な資料を見つけるのに苦労しています。SDKは持っているのですが、付属のサンプルは飾りやウィンドウ、アイコンなどのようです。

テキスト エディターで直接動作する拡張機能を作成しようとしています (たとえば、クラス内のすべてのメソッド名をアルファベット順に並べ替える、またはすべての定数名を大文字にする) が、このタイプの機能のデモが見つかりません。 、またはチュートリアルです。

この種のものをどこで見つけることができるか知っている人はいますか?

0 投票する
1 に答える
425 参照

visual-studio-2010 - usingステートメントがない場合でもインテリセンスに拡張メソッドを追加するVisualStudio2010拡張

using System.Linq;拡張メソッドの追加に慣れてきましIEnumerableたが、クラスで拡張メソッドを使用しようとして、それがインテリセンスで表示されず、何が何であるかを理解するのに非常に多くの時間を費やしたことがあります。 VisualStudioが見つけられなかったusingステートメントが必要だと気付く前に間違っていました。Ctrl標準+機能で拡張メソッドを見つけるVS2010拡張はあり. View.ShowSmartTagますか?

0 投票する
2 に答える
840 参照

c# - VS2010拡張性:カスタムドキュメントフォーマット

こんにちは、

Verilog言語を有効なコンテンツタイプとして登録するVisualStudioパッケージを作成しました。

構文の強調表示、アウトライン、スマートインデントなどがすべて機能しています。

ただし、VisualStudioでドキュメント全体を自動的にフォーマットできるようにしたいと思いますEdit->Advanced->Format Document/Selection。現在、これらのオプションは表示されていません。これらのメソッドを呼び出すことができることをVS2010に(何らかの方法で)知らせ、このフォーマットを行うための正しいメソッドを提供する必要があると思います。

VS2010SDKとドキュメントにフォーマットへの参照が見つからないようです。ISmartIndentそれが私が探していた解決策になること を望んでいましたが、このコードは空の行でのみ実行されるか、Enterキーが押されたときにのみ実行されるようです。

この問題を解決するためのヒントやアイデアはありますか?

ありがとう、

ジャワ

編集:これを実現するために、VS2010で導入されたマネージド拡張フレームワークを使用しています。私はC#で書いています(そして質問にc#タグを追加しただけです)。ありがとう

0 投票する
2 に答える
4193 参照

visual-studio - Visual Studio 2010 内の To Do リスト アプリケーション

VS 2010 用の適切な To Do リスト拡張機能はありますか? 私は ReSharper To-do Explorer とコメントの正規表現を使用するのが好きですが、いくつかのリマインダー/タスクなどのために、コードにコメントを追加する必要はありません。特にタスクが一般的で、特定のコードに固有ではない場合はそうです。 . ただし、VS 2010 のタスク リストは非常に原始的であり、他のタスクには不格好です。

0 投票する
2 に答える
3395 参照

visual-studio - 「お気に入り」のフォルダーとファイルに対するVisualStudioの拡張機能はありますか?

私は、いくつかのクラスライブラリ、データベースモデル、およびASP .NETMVCWebサイトプロジェクトを含む中規模のプロジェクトに取り組んでいます。ただし、ソリューションに含まれるプロジェクトは15未満ですが、特定のクラスまたはビューを見つけるために、無限のフォルダーを折りたたんだり展開したりすることがよくあります

クラスの検索は主にResharperタイプのナビゲーション機能によって解決されますが、MVCプロジェクトで特定のビューに切り替えたいことがよくあります。ファイル名を覚えていません。同じファイル名のビューが多数あるため(たとえばMessage\ViewSingle.cshtmlProduct\ViewSingle.cshtml)、問題は解決しません。

私が望んでいるのは、特定のファイル、プロジェクト、またはフォルダーを「お気に入り」にして、すばやくアクセスできるように別のソリューションエクスプローラーのようなウィンドウに表示する機能です。

そのような拡張機能は(無料で)利用できますか?

アップデート

@samyは、SergeyVlasovFavoriteDocuments拡張機能を使用すると、メニューバーからすばやくアクセスできると指摘しました。私は通常、メニューバーを非表示にする傾向があり、ドッキング可能なウィンドウソリューションを好むので、まだ探しています。私はセルゲイに、彼がこの機能に取り組む予定があるかどうかを調べるために書いた。

更新(8月4日)

セルゲイから、FavoriteDocuments1.1に専用のウィンドウが表示されていることを示す手紙が届きました。したがって、私はサミーの答えを受け入れます。

0 投票する
1 に答える
1342 参照

visual-studio - カーソル下の識別子の完全なタイプ名をクリップボードにコピーするVSアドオン

カーソルの下にある識別子の完全なタイプ名をクリップボードにコピーするためのVisualStudioアドオンはありますか?「VS2010-クラス/インターフェイスの完全な型名をコピーする簡単な方法」にリンクしないでください。マクロを扱いたくありません。アドオンのみ。ありがとう :)

0 投票する
3 に答える
11708 参照

visual-studio-2010 - What are the little coloured bits on my vertical scroll bar in Visual Studio 2010?

I have only recently paid any attention to the appearance of little green and blue rectangles on my vertical scroll bar in code editing windows in VS2010. Can anyone tell me what these are?

I'm running with the Productivity Power Tools extension and ReSharper 6.

0 投票する
2 に答える
1617 参照

c# - Visual Studio のテーマの色がいつ変更されるかを確認するにはどうすればよいですか?

ツール ウィンドウを使用して Visual Studio パッケージを開発します。ツール ウィンドウの UI は WPF に基づいています。私のユーザー コントロールでは、VS デザインに対応する現在の Visual Studio テーマの色を使用したいと考えています。

したがって、私の質問は、Visual Studio のテーマの色が変更されたことを確認する方法です。

前もって感謝します。

0 投票する
1 に答える
180 参照

visual-studio-2010 - ファイルをフォルダーにグループ化するためのVisualStudio2010拡張機能

ファイルを仮想フォルダにグループ化できる拡張機能を探しています。

例:

3つのプロジェクトで解決策があります。UI(MVC)、セキュリティレイヤー、BusinessLayer/DAL。

3つのプロジェクトのそれぞれには、「ユーザー管理」などを処理するクラス/ビューがいくつかあります。

  • UI:ビュー、コントローラー、ViewModels
  • セキュリティレイヤー:セキュリティチェック
  • BL / DAL:ビジネスロジック、データアクセス

私が欲しいのは、「論理ソリューションエクスプローラー」のような拡張機能で、仮想フォルダーを作成し、その中にすべての「ユーザー管理」クラス/ビューへのリンクを配置できます。

そのようなものはありますか?